¿Se puede instalar Vanilla Android en cualquier teléfono? [duplicar]

Tengo un Samsung Galaxy S3. TouchWiz es genial, pero quiero usar el sistema operativo Android estándar que ves en el Nexus 4. ¿Es esto posible?

Respuestas (2)

En teoría, debería ser posible compilar Android desde la fuente, con blobs propietarios para el dispositivo específico.

En la práctica, sin embargo, esto es en gran medida imposible, con la excepción de los dispositivos Nexus y los de fabricantes comunitarios como Sony.

Samsung, en particular, es conocido por proporcionar fuentes terriblemente (des)organizadas, e incluso los talentosos piratas informáticos del equipo de Cyanogenmod están frustrados, y muchos han vendido sus dispositivos y se han mudado a dispositivos Sony y Nexus.

Entonces, su única opción realista es instalar una ROM comunitaria como CM10.1. Una vez más, no está libre de errores ni tiene todas las funciones del firmware estándar.

CM está sesgado hacia Samsung y que el creador de CM trabaja para Samsung, por lo que obtiene todos los regalos y lanza CM más orientado hacia Samsung. Sí, Samsung ha causado frustración porque no son exactamente comunicativos, mire el conjunto de chips Exynos que Samsung se negó a revelar... y, por lo tanto, CM tampoco es el más brillante ni el más estable, ese último comentario es mi sesgo personal de disgusto por CM. de todos modos :)
Puede que tengas tus razones para odiar tanto a CM, pero al menos entiende bien los hechos. Solo Steve Kondik trabaja para Samsung, pero CM es un gran proyecto con docenas de mantenedores. La razón por la que CM tiene lanzamientos para Samsung rápidamente es porque es el OEM número 1, lo que significa más usuarios que quieren ROM personalizadas y también más desarrolladores que tienen el dispositivo para jugar. Si sigue a los desarrolladores de CM en Google+, verá que muchos han vendido sus dispositivos Samsung y están comenzando con Sony. Recuerda mis palabras, Xperia T y los más nuevos recibirán un excelente soporte de desarrollo pronto.
¡Sé que Sony va a salir perdiendo en esto! ;) no dijo nada

Sí, hay dos vías:

  • Descargue una ROM AOSP vainilla que apunta a SGSIII proporcionada
    • Su teléfono está rooteado y ejecutando una recuperación personalizada
    • Destella el update.zipde esa ROM AOSP que apunta a lo mismo.
  • Construya su propio desde cero proporcionado
    • Su computadora de escritorio, tiene mucho espacio en disco y ejecuta Linux de 64 bits
    • Montones de RAM, 8 Gb mínimo, y es un núcleo cuádruple o mejor
    • Descargue la fuente de Android del repositorio de código oficial .
    • Rellene el árbol de dispositivos que coincida con su dispositivo, con blobs propietarios
    • Tenga una o dos horas de tiempo libre, ya que lleva un tiempo compilar y finalmente escupir un system.img, boot.imgyupdate.zip
Estoy considerando construir un Android Vanilla desde la fuente para mi teléfono, pero no entendí este punto: "Rellene el árbol de dispositivos que coincida con su dispositivo, con blobs propietarios". ¿Puede aclararlo? ¡¿Qué quieres decir con manchas también?!
Compré un Alcatel Hero 2 y quiero tener Android Vanilla en él